An idyllic location
Despite being home to a modest selection of restaurants, Artimino is all about serenity. So, if you fancy heading a bit closer to civilisation, then there are plenty of places within driving distance. The town of Signa lies around 12km east and is a great spot for sightseeing and stocking up on essentials.

What is Artimino like for holidays?
Artimino holidays offer a peaceful and authentic Tuscan experience, set among rolling hills, vineyards and olive groves. This charming medieval village provides a tranquil atmosphere, making it ideal for travellers seeking relaxation, scenic views and a taste of traditional Italian countryside life.
Is Artimino good for a quiet holiday?
Yes, Artimino is perfect for a quiet holiday, as it is far removed from busy tourist resorts. Its rural setting, slow pace and stunning surroundings make it particularly appealing for couples and those looking to unwind in a peaceful environment.
Are there attractions near Artimino?
Artimino is well located for exploring Tuscany, with Florence, Pisa and Lucca all within driving distance. Visitors can also explore nearby vineyards, historic villas and charming countryside towns, making it an excellent base for cultural day trips.
When is the best time to visit Artimino?
The best time to visit Artimino is between April and October, when the weather is warm and ideal for exploring the countryside. Spring and early autumn are particularly attractive, offering mild temperatures and beautiful scenery without peak summer crowds.
What can you do in Artimino?
Visitors can enjoy wine tasting, explore scenic walking routes, visit historic villas such as Villa Medicea La Ferdinanda, and experience authentic Tuscan cuisine. It is also a great base for discovering nearby cultural cities and picturesque villages.
